Understanding the Components of a packaged drinking water manufacturing plant High-speed
The packaged drinking water manufacturing plant High-speed is an intricate system designed to efficiently produce bottled water at impressive rates. Central to this process is the bottle blow molding machine, which shapes preforms into bottles using high-pressure air. This machine operates swiftly, significantly reducing production time while ensuring that the bottles are durable and meet safety standards.

The water treatment system is another critical component of the packaged drinking water manufacturing plant High-speed. This system utilizes advanced filtration and purification techniques to ensure that the water meets all health regulations. It removes contaminants and provides safe drinking water, which is essential for maintaining product integrity in the competitive bottled water market.
In addition to these crucial machines, the packaged drinking water manufacturing plant High-speed also features a bottle unscrambler. This machine plays a vital role in organizing and preparing bottles for filling. By automatically sorting and aligning the bottles, it minimizes manual labor and streamlines the entire production line, enhancing efficiency and productivity.
The Efficiency of Filling and Packaging in a Packaged Drinking Water Manufacturing Plant High-speed
Filling machines are indispensable in the packaged drinking water manufacturing plant High-speed. These machines are capable of filling bottles with precision and speed, accommodating various bottle sizes and types. Utilizing advanced technology, they ensure that each bottle is filled to the correct level without any spillage, which is crucial for maintaining quality and minimizing waste.
After filling, the bottled water needs to be sealed and labeled, and this is where the labeling machine comes into play. In a packaged drinking water manufacturing plant High-speed, these machines apply labels quickly and accurately, ensuring that branding is consistent and regulatory information is clear. This not only enhances the product’s marketability but also ensures compliance with industry standards.
To complete the process, film shrink and carton packing machines are employed. These machines provide protective packaging for the bottles, making them easy to transport and store. The use of these machines in the packaged drinking water manufacturing plant High-speed ensures that the end product is shelf-ready and meets customer expectations for both quality and presentation.
